The Significance of the Skull in Forensic Identification

The skull, being the most robust and durable part of the human skeleton, often survives even in cases of severe decomposition or trauma. This resilience makes it a valuable resource for forensic investigators. The skull's unique features, such as the shape of the nasal bones, the size and position of the eye sockets, and the configuration of the teeth, can provide crucial information about an individual's identity. These features, when analyzed in conjunction with other skeletal remains, can help determine the individual's age, sex, ancestry, and even potential cause of death.

Techniques for Skull-Based Identification

Forensic anthropologists employ a variety of techniques to extract information from the skull for identification purposes. One common method involves craniofacial reconstruction, where a clay model of the face is built upon the skull, using anatomical landmarks and tissue depth measurements. This technique can provide a visual representation of the individual's appearance, aiding in identification efforts. Another technique, anthropometric analysis, involves measuring various dimensions of the skull, such as the width of the face, the height of the skull, and the length of the jawbone. These measurements can be compared to databases of known individuals or statistical averages to narrow down the possibilities.

The Role of Dental Evidence

Teeth, being the hardest substance in the human body, often survive even in extreme conditions. Dental records, including the arrangement, shape, and fillings of teeth, can be a powerful tool for identification. Forensic odontologists, specialists in dental identification, compare dental records with the teeth of the deceased to establish a positive match. This method is particularly effective when other identification methods are unavailable or inconclusive.

The Importance of Cranial Sutures

Cranial sutures, the lines where the bones of the skull meet, provide valuable information about an individual's age. These sutures gradually fuse together as a person ages, following a predictable pattern. By examining the degree of fusion, forensic anthropologists can estimate the age of the deceased, even in cases where other age indicators are absent.

The Use of DNA Analysis

Advances in DNA technology have revolutionized forensic identification. DNA can be extracted from bone, teeth, and even hair found on the skull. This genetic material can be compared to DNA profiles in databases or from known relatives, providing a highly accurate and reliable method for identification.
